| 51221 | Pyramids fail to build for NITF images in read-only directories |
| ArcMap™ will try to create three files (*.rrd, *.aux.xml, and *.aux) when building pyramids. These files are written into the directory where the NITF image resides. If this directory is read only, these files can not be created and ArcMap will fail to build pyramids. To work around this issue, the NITF image can be moved to a directory where the ArcMap user has write permissions.. | |
| 51488 | Some very large images do not display when opened |
| Depending on the ratio between the cell size on the screen, and the cell size available in the image, ArcGIS switches between Block IO, when the ratio is small, and Raster IO (resampled IO), when it's large. In BlockIO mode, ArcGIS can fail to allocate memory, and when this happens the image will not display initially. To workaround this issue you can use the ArcMap Zoom to Raster Resolution option or slowly zoom in until the NITF image displays. | |
